How to Filter People on Bluesky with Precision
- Profile Content Search: Find accounts using specific keywords in their bio/profile (e.g., “montreal AND artist”)
- Engagement Metrics: Filter by follower count ranges, following counts, and activity levels
- Account Quality: Hide unfollowed/rejected accounts, exclude followers/follows, maximize engagement results
- Account Quality Filters: Account creation date, profile photo presence, verification status
- Exclusion Filters: Find accounts containing specific words in their profiles
đź’ˇ Search Capabilities: Fedica’s search tools focus on profile content, engagement metrics, and account quality. While demographic search filters are not available, these tools provide powerful targeting based on what people actually share in their profiles and how they engage with content.
How to Sort Bluesky Search Results for Better Discovery
- Sort by influence, follower count, following count, date created, or number of posts
- Ascending/descending order for all sort criteria
- Fast results with instant filtering updates

Step 1: How to Access Fedica’s Bluesky Search Tools
Log into your Fedica account and navigate to the Bluesky Search & Explore section where you can search keywords in people’s profiles. You’ll see a comprehensive interface with multiple filtering options that go far beyond what Bluesky offers natively.
Step 2: How to Define Your Target Audience on Bluesky
Think strategically about who you want to find. Are you looking for potential clients, industry collaborators, or community members? Define specific keywords or professional backgrounds.
Fedica’s search interface makes it easy to input multiple criteria at once.

Step 3: How to Apply Advanced Filters on Bluesky
Use the advanced filtering options to narrow your search.
Start with profile content search, then add “max engagement” filter to find the most relevant accounts.
Fedica’s algorithm will quickly show you people who match your exact criteria.
Step 4: How to Sort and Analyze Your Bluesky Search Results
Sort your results by influence, engagement, or other criteria that matter for your goals. Look for patterns and identify the most promising connections.
Fedica’s sorting options help you prioritize the accounts most likely to become valuable community members.
